Sierra Canyon strolled into their game on Thursday with a perfect record and they left with the same. They blew past the Orange Lutheran Lancers, posting a 41-9 victory. The score at the end of the third wound up being the final score as the Trailblazers just coasted through the last quarter.
Sierra Canyon's win was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Jaxsen Stokes, who rushed for 48 yards and three scores, and also picked up 39 receiving yards. Laird Finkel was another key signal caller, throwing for 273 yards and a pair of TDs while picking up 10.9 yards per attempt.

Special teams also deserves some recognition, posting 11 points in total. The biggest highlight from special teams (and perhaps the team as a whole) came courtesy of Havon Finney Jr., who ran a punt back for a touchdown.
Sierra Canyon's win bumped their record up to 5-0. As for Orange Lutheran, their defeat dropped their record down to 3-2.
Sierra Canyon and Orange Lutheran will both get a bit of extra prep time before their next games. The next time the Trailblazers see the field they'll take on Serra at 7:00 p.m. on October 3. As for Orange Lutheran, their break will end when they face Mater Dei at 7:00 p.m. on October 3.
